Cincinnati Reds Minor League Recap: Top Performances From August 20, 2025

Four Cincinnati Reds Minor League affiliates were in action on Wednesday. Here are the top performances from those games:

Louisville Bats (53-69) Lost 7-5

Chattanooga Lookouts (62-49) Won 6-3

  • Edwin Arroyo went 2-5 with a solo home run and two runs scored.
  • Cam Collier went 1-3 with two walks, a RBI a nd a run scored.
  • Jay Allen II went 2-5 with two RBIs and a stolen base.
  • Trevor Kuncl pitched one inning with three hits, three runs, a walk and a strikeout.
  • Austin Hendrick went 1-5 with three strikeouts.
  • TJ Sikkema pitched five inning with six hits, a walk and a strikeout.

Dayton Dragons (37-75) Won 2-1

  • Johnny Ascanio went 2-4 with a run scored.
  • Carlos Sanchez went 1-4.
  • John Michael Faile went 1-3 with a solo home run.
  • Anthony Stephan went 0-3 with a walk and a stolen base.
  • Luke Hayden pitched 5 2/3 innings with six hits, one run, two walks and five strikeouts.

Daytona Tortugas (56-60) Won 8-4

  • Mason Neville went 4-4 with a three-run home run, a double, a walk, and two runs scored. His home run was his first as a professional.
  • Alfredo Duno went 1-3 with a two-run home run and two walks.
  • Tyson Lewis went 2-5 with a triple, RBI and a run scored.
  • Kien Vu went 1-5 with an RBI, stolen base and a run scored.
  • Alfredo Alcantara went 1-5 with a stolen base and an RBI.
  • Kyle Henley went 2-2 with three walks, three stolen bases, a double and two runs scored.
  • Beau Blanchard pitched 5 1/3 innings with four hits, one walk and six strikeouts.
